mirror of
https://github.com/songquanpeng/one-api.git
synced 2025-11-20 15:13:44 +08:00
- Add message content validation in getAndValidateAnthropicRequest - Filter out messages with empty content to prevent 'all messages must have non-empty content' errors - Support both text and non-text content validation (images, tool_use, tool_result) - Add detailed logging for filtered messages - Ensure at least one valid message remains after filtering 修复Anthropic协议空消息内容问题: - 在getAndValidateAnthropicRequest中添加消息内容验证 - 过滤空内容消息以防止'all messages must have non-empty content'错误 - 支持文本和非文本内容验证(图片、工具调用、工具结果) - 为被过滤的消息添加详细日志记录 - 确保过滤后至少保留一条有效消息